    Abstract

    The eosin is used to sensitize dichromated gelatin holographic recording material and photoacoustic spectroscopy (PAS)is adopted to measure its absorption spectrum.The experimental results prove that the eosin is a new and valauable spectral sensitized dye for dichromated gelatin.With the sensitization by the eosin,the dichromated gelatin's absorption becomes higher at 514.5 nm.Thus,this material can be advantageously used for recording full-color holograms and making holographic optical elements. At the same time, these results also show that PAS is an extremely effective way for the measurement of spectral sensitization and photochemical processes of holographic recording materials.
